Virat Kohli lauds UAE's Ibrar Ahmad Dawar for impressive bowling in nets

NEW DELHI: United Arab Emirates (UAE) cricketer Ibrar Ahmad Dawar has received high praise from Indian superstar Virat Kohli ahead of the much-anticipated ICC Champions Trophy clash against Pakistan in Dubai.

Ibrar shared a video on his official Instagram account where Kohli acknowledged his impressive bowling efforts in the nets. In the clip, the Indian batting maestro can be heard saying, "Well bowled... he has really bowled well. He has helped a lot. Thank you."

The UAE cricketer was seen bowling aggressively to Kohli during the practice session, with the 36-year-old batter flicking him at one point. Ibrar’s intensity and skills in the nets seemingly caught Kohli’s attention.

Previously, Ibrar showcased his talent while playing for the Abu Dhabi Knight Riders (ADKR) in the International League T20 (ILT20), impressing with his performances.

Meanwhile, the much-anticipated clash between India and Pakistan is crucial for the defending champions. Pakistan must win to keep their title hopes alive after suffering a 60-run defeat against New Zealand in their tournament opener.

India, on the other hand, made a strong start, securing a dominant 6-wicket victory over Bangladesh.

Kohli has been in prolific form against Pakistan in ODIs, scoring 678 runs in 16 matches at an average of 52.15, including three centuries and two fifties.
